The governing body of Tobyhanna, Pennsylvania, is the Tobyhanna Township Board of Supervisors, which consists of five elected members. Each supervisor is elected to a term of six years, with elections held in odd-numbered years. The current members include Chairman Thomas A. McCarthy, Vice Chairman John J. Duffy, and Supervisors Michael J. McCarthy, Robert J. Kline, and Richard J. Kline.
For the fiscal year 2023, Tobyhanna Township has an approximate annual operating budget of $3.5 million. This budget supports various township services, including public safety, infrastructure maintenance, and community development initiatives.
Regular meetings of the Tobyhanna Township Board of Supervisors are held on the first and third Wednesday of each month at 7:00 PM. These meetings take place at the Tobyhanna Township Municipal Building, located at 105 Government Center Way, Tobyhanna, PA 18466. Residents are encouraged to attend to stay informed about local governance and community issues.
